What Is High-end Camping (Glamping)?



High-end outdoor camping, or glamping, refers to pre-set accommodations in all-natural setups that blend the appeal of the outdoors with hotel-like facilities. Believe safari tents with luxurious king beds, treehouse resorts with private decks, geodesic domes with stargazing skylights, or yurts outfitted with wood-burning ranges and comfy rugs.

The essential allure is simplicity. You show up, and every little thing is currently there waiting for you-- no arrangement, no packaging notes that stretch 3 web pages long, and no compromises on comfort.

Disadvantages of Deluxe Camping



The most significant disadvantage is cost. Glamping holiday accommodations can run anywhere from $150 to over $1,000 per evening, placing them securely in the store resort rate array. You're additionally secured right into one area for your keep, which restricts the sense of liberty and exploration that lots of people associate with outdoor camping.

What Is recreational vehicle Outdoor camping?



Recreational vehicle outdoor camping includes taking a trip in a motorhome, camper van, or tent for 6 persons a lorry towing a trailer that functions as your mobile home. You prepare your very own dishes, sleep in your very own area, and get up anywhere you parked-- whether that's a lakeside camping area, a desert neglect, or a national forest.

RVing is the traditional road-trip fantasy completely recognized. Your home trips with you, which indicates you can comply with the climate, chase after sundowns, or simply change your mind concerning where you're do without any type of penalty.

Pros of RV Outdoor Camping



Flexibility is the defining advantage of RV travel. You're not linked to one location. A single two-week trip can take you through mountain woodlands, coastal towns, and canyon landscapes-- all from the convenience of your own rolling living room.

RVing additionally ends up being more affordable over time. When you possess or rent a recreational vehicle, your holiday accommodation costs are significantly lower than hotels or glamping sites. Campsite costs at national and state parks commonly vary from $20 to $50 per evening, making prolonged travel surprisingly budget friendly. Family members, specifically, can discover this design of travel even more budget-friendly than typical holidays.

There's additionally something deeply pleasing about the self-sufficiency of recreational vehicle life. You lug your cooking area, your room, and your restroom with you-- it constructs a feeling of ability and self-reliance that couple of travel styles can match.

Disadvantages of Recreational Vehicle Outdoor Camping



RVing features real duties. Preserving a lorry, taking care of waste systems, learning to back right into tight camping sites, and handling the occasional mechanical misstep all need patience and a willingness to problem-solve. The understanding curve, especially for first-timers, can be high.

Setup and traveling also require time. Driving a motor home is slower and extra exhausting than a routine trip, and reaching a new site includes leveling the lorry, connecting utilities, and obtaining worked out-- which can eat into your journey time.
